First, verify your rental agreement: most providers allow returns within 24–48 hours, but fees apply after that window. Some offer airport return lanes with priority processing—ideal if available. Second, confirm insurance status: proper coverage can waive penalties when returning the vehicle in good condition. Third, return promptly, ideally within the allowed time, to keep fee-free status.

Critical to speed: documentation and communication. Waiting too long to report damage or missing keys triggers hold fees. Acting immediately—filming defects, keeping receipts—speeds verification. Finally, use mobile check-in and return portals, which reduce wait times and paperwork. These steps form The Ultimate Shortcut—efficiency without compromise.
Yet, it’s crucial to balance speed with responsibility. Hasty returns without checks risk oversights. The key is informed action—not speed for speed’s sake.
